Is Chicago or Moscow Safer?

According to crimebycity.com's analysis of 2024 FBI data, Moscow is safer than Chicago (Safety Score 73/100 vs 8/100), with a total crime rate of 1,034 per 100,000 versus 4,012 for Chicago — 74% lower. Chicago has higher rates in 0 of 7 crime categories.

The biggest difference is in murder, where Moscow has a 100% lower rate.

Note: Chicago is 98.9x larger by coverage, which can affect crime rate comparisons. Larger cities tend to report higher rates due to density and more comprehensive reporting.

Detailed Crime Rate Comparison

Crime Type Chicago Moscow Difference
Total Crime Rate 4,012.2 1,034.3 +2,977.9
Violent Crime Rate 539.9 18.7 +521.1
Murder Rate 17.5 0.0 +17.5
Rape Rate 58.8 0.0 +58.8
Robbery Rate 335.3 0.0 +335.3
Aggravated Assault Rate 128.3 18.7 +109.6
Property Crime Rate 3,472.4 1,015.6 +2,456.8
Burglary Rate 294.8 108.7 +186.1
Larceny-Theft Rate 2,318.8 884.4 +1,434.3
Motor Vehicle Theft Rate 858.9 22.5 +836.4

All rates per 100,000 residents. Source: FBI UCR 2024.
